Konwertuj PDF na XML w C#
PowerPoint .NET API do konwertowania dokumentów PDF na pliki XML na platformach NET Framework, .NET Core, Windows Azure, Mono lub Xamarin
Jak przekonwertować PDF na XML w C#
Jak przekonwertować plik PDF na XML w kodzie?
Używając Aspose.Slides for .NET , każdy programista lub aplikacja może konwertować pliki PDF na XML za pomocą zaledwie kilku wierszy kodu C#.
Jako nowoczesny interfejs API do przetwarzania dokumentów, Aspose.Slides for .NET szybko eksportuje strony PDF do formatu XML. Biblioteka Aspose PowerPoint umożliwia konwersję plików PDF do XML i wielu innych formatów plików.
Aby zainstalować Aspose.Slides: Otwórz menedżera pakietów NuGet . Wyszukaj Aspose.Slides i zainstaluj go.
Możesz też zainstalować Aspose.Slides, uruchamiając to polecenie z konsoli Menedżera pakietów.
Polecenie konsoli menedżera pakietów
PM> Install-Package Aspose.Slides.NET
Jak przekonwertować PDF na XML w C#
Programiści i aplikacje mogą konwertować pliki PDF na XML w ten sposób:
Utwórz wystąpienie klasy Presentation.
Załaduj plik PDF.
Dodaj slajdy na podstawie stron PDF.
Zapisz slajdy w formacie XML.
wymagania systemowe
Przed uruchomieniem kodu C# konwersji PDF na XML komputer musi spełniać następujące wymagania wstępne:
- Microsoft Windows lub kompatybilny system operacyjny z platformami .NET Framework, .NET Core, Windows Azure, Mono lub Xamarin.
- Środowisko programistyczne, takie jak Microsoft Visual Studio.
- W projekcie odniesiono się do Aspose.Slides dla .NET DLL.
Kod C# do konwersji PDF na XML
using (Presentation pres = new Presentation())
{
pres.Slides.AddFromPdf("doc.pdf");
pres.Slides.RemoveAt(0); // removes default empty slide
for (var index = 0; index < pres.Slides.Count; index++)
{
ISlide slide = pres.Slides[index];
using (FileStream stream = new FileStream($"doc-{index}.xml", FileMode.Create, FileAccess.Write))
{
slide.WriteAsSvg(stream);
}
}
}
Darmowy konwerter online
Inne obsługiwane konwersje
Aspose.Slides obsługuje operacje konwersji dla wielu formatów plików